Cook the lentils in water for 20 minutes, then drain and let cool slightly.
20 min
Toast the crushed walnuts and diced ham in a pan for 4 minutes.
4 min
Mix the cooled lentils with the walnuts, ham, grated ginger and 20g of butter.
5 min
Cut the bananas in half lengthwise and partially hollow them out to create a cavity.
5 min
Fill the banana halves with the mixture and arrange on a baking sheet, then bake for 12 minutes at 190°C.
12 min
Prepare the sauce by mixing the miso, soy sauce, honey and remaining butter in a saucepan.
3 min
Remove the bananas from the oven and generously coat with the miso-butter sauce before serving.
2 min
